Retale, the Germany-founded app that aggregates retail circulars for shoppers, has brought in a US head of corporate communications after launching here last year.

Tim Gray, a former journalist who handled communications for Blue Foundation Media and Mediaander.com, has joined Chicago-based Retale in the top US PR post.

Retale, owned by Bonial International Group, counts 60 retailers as customers of its location-based service, including Target, Kohl's and Toys "R" Us. The company said its app was downloaded one million times after its October launch in the US. It is available globally as kaufDA (Germany), bonial (France), Lokata (Russia), Ofertia (Spain), and Guiato (Brazil).

FleishmanHillard handles Retale's PR account.

Gray covered the finance, business and tech beats reporting for outlets like MSNBC, CBS Interactive and TechNewsdaily.com. He earlier reported for the Staten Island Advance.

Retale held a press conference in January with Chicago Mayor Rahm Emanuel to announce its US presence with plans to hire 60 staffers over the next several years.
